So, I was playing again this weekend. And took one 120mm Coolermaster Tri-blade and ripped it apart. Then I proceeded to make a converter which would hold the fan blades to the hdd motor. I then went to mount the motor to the fan chassis. And voila. (Ignore the white specs on it, was a failed attempt with some UV chemicals)
